What is an unclaimed benefit fund?

Unclaimed benefits are benefits where the reason for the member’s leaving the Fund and his or her last day of service are both known, but the benefit is not paid to the member or beneficiary within 24 months of the last day of service in line with the rules of the Fund.

How do I claim Provident Fund?

You need to contact the HR department of each of your former employers and a) find out where your money is; 2) request a withdrawal form if the money is still in the employer’s retirement fund; or 3) request the contact details for the administrator who looks after the unclaimed benefit fund if the money has already …

How to return unclaimed money?

Establish a Procedure for Dealing with Unclaimed Paychecks Set a “to do” note on your payroll calendar for the end of each year and run a report that shows the information for each paycheck. Then, send out the certified letters. Finally, follow your state’s requirements for returning unclaimed paychecks for those ex-employees who haven’t cashed checks.

  • How do I check for unclaimed money?

    Individuals can check for unclaimed money in Louisiana by visiting the unclaimed property division page at the Louisiana Department of the Treasury website. An online claims form is accessible by clicking the search for lost money link. Searchers must provide a personal or company name, address and city.
